Day 3: Mountain-Ringed Innsbruck
Location: Innsbruck, Heidelberg, Neuschwanstein Castle
Accommodation: AC Hotel Innsbruck.
Accommodation Name: AC Hotel Innsbruck
Meals Included: Breakfast
Skirt the northern Black Forest and head towards the rolling Bavarian Alps. Stop beneath the royal castles of Hohenschwangau and King Ludwig’s Neuschwanstein, rumoured to have inspired Walt Disney's iconic castle. Once over the Austrian border, continue to the Tyrolean capital of Innsbruck. Tour the architectural jewels of the city, seeing the Imperial Palace, Golden Roof and the 14th century houses of the Old Town.

Day 10: The Alps And On To Lucerne
Location: Lucerne, Florence
Accommodation: Hotel Astoria, Lucerne.
Accommodation Name: Hotel Astoria
Meals Included: Breakfast
In the morning, travel across the Swiss border. The emotive Lion Monument, carved into a limestone cliff, is a memorial dedicated to the heroic Swiss Guards who died defending King Louis XVI during the French Revolution, which is a source of great pride to the people of Lucerne. See this beautiful work before strolling across the Chapel Bridge to see the ornate Jesuit Church. The afternoon is at your leisure. You may choose to enjoy a cruise on Lake Lucerne with its dramatic vistas.
